Identification Hooper & Wiedenmayer (1994) list two synonyms for Echinonema anchoratum var. ramosa Von Lendenfeld, 1888, one (on p. 51) as a species of Phorbas, and the other (on p.360) as a synonym of Raspailia (Clathriodendron) arbuscula (Von Lendenfeld, 1888), citing for both the holotype reg.nr. AM Z109. The two different identities are probably caused by the fact that according to Hallmann (1912: 299), the latter identity is based on a misapplication of the combination by Whitelegge (1901: 81). The confusion is possibly caused by the possibility that the holotype sample was in fact a syntype containing two different species. [details]
